An Infrastructure for Developing Mobile Applications on a Connected Data Cloud
Journal Title: Gazi Üniversitesi Fen Bilimleri Dergisi Part C: Tasarım ve Teknoloji - Year 2013, Vol 1, Issue 3
Abstract
Linked data, which is the current realization of the semantic web, depends on the idea of publishing datasets on the web using the RDF standard and associating different datasets using RDF links. Linked data space has continously expanded since the linked data concept was first introduced by Tim Berners-Lee in 2006, and it became an open linked data cloud which is referred to as the "web of data". On the other hand, advances in mobile device and communication technologies brought mobile applications into prominance in accessing to data and services on the Internet. Accordingly, mobile applications which can use the semantically related data to fulfill their requirements will play an important role in realizing semantic web in mobile environments. In this study, an infrastructure, which has been built to ease the development of mobile applications on the linkeddata cloud, is introduced. This infrastructure provides the necessary means of querying linked data sets and of focusing on some specific part of the linked data cloud to monitor the changes that would occur in that part. The developed infrastructure handles the interaction of the linked data cloud and mobile applications using a separate abstraction called linked data environment. Linked data environment depends on the environment abstraction used in multi-agent systems and the A&A (Agents and Artifacts) meta-model which is used to model the environment.
